legongju.com
我们一直在努力
2025-01-09 16:22 | 星期四

Oracle数据库substr函数返回值是什么

Oracle数据库中的SUBSTR函数返回字符串的一部分。其语法结构为:

SUBSTR(string, start[, length])
  • string:要从中提取子字符串的原始字符串。
  • start:子字符串开始的位置(以1为起始索引)。如果省略,则从字符串的第一个字符开始。
  • length:要返回的子字符串的长度。如果省略,则返回从start位置到原始字符串末尾的所有字符。

例如,如果有一个名为employees的表,其中包含一个名为employee_name的列,你可以使用以下查询来提取每个员工名字的姓氏(假设姓氏始终位于名字的左侧两个字符中):

SELECT SUBSTR(employee_name, 1, 2) AS last_name FROM employees;

这将返回一个结果集,其中包含每个员工名字的姓氏。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/78630.html

相关推荐

  • Oracle模型子句在商业智能系统中的应用

    Oracle模型子句在商业智能系统中的应用

    Oracle模型子句在商业智能系统中扮演着重要的角色,特别是在数据分析和处理方面。以下是关于Oracle模型子句在商业智能系统中应用的详细信息:
    Oracle模型子...

  • 如何结合Oracle模型子句进行数据挖掘

    如何结合Oracle模型子句进行数据挖掘

    Oracle模型子句是一种强大的工具,它允许用户在SQL查询中定义复杂的分析操作,包括排名、分组和聚合等,从而进行数据挖掘、预测和模式识别等高级分析。以下是关于...

  • Oracle模型子句在多维数据分析中的作用

    Oracle模型子句在多维数据分析中的作用

    Oracle模型子句在多维数据分析中扮演着至关重要的角色,它允许用户定义复杂的数据模型结构,从而更好地管理和分析数据。以下是Oracle模型子句在多维数据分析中的...

  • 使用Oracle模型子句时需要注意哪些问题

    使用Oracle模型子句时需要注意哪些问题

    在使用Oracle模型子句时,有一些常见的问题和注意事项: 确保数据完整性:在创建模型之前,请确保数据表中的数据是完整且准确的。错误的数据可能导致模型预测不准...

  • MyBatis中sqlId怎样避免冲突

    MyBatis中sqlId怎样避免冲突

    在 MyBatis 中,为了避免 sqlId 冲突,可以采取以下几种策略: 命名规范:遵循统一的命名规范是避免冲突的基础。对于每个 SQL 语句,都应该为其分配一个唯一且描...

  • Oracle数据库substr函数参数怎么设置

    Oracle数据库substr函数参数怎么设置

    在Oracle数据库中,SUBSTR函数用于从字符串中提取子字符串。其基本语法为:
    SUBSTR(string, start, length) 其中: string 是要从中提取子字符串的原始字符...

  • MyBatis的sqlId如何影响性能

    MyBatis的sqlId如何影响性能

    MyBatis 的 sqlId 对于性能的影响主要体现在以下几个方面: 缓存机制:MyBatis 会对 sqlId 进行缓存。当第一次执行一个带有 sqlId 的 SQL 语句时,MyBatis 会将这...

  • ubuntu集群负载均衡咋设置

    ubuntu集群负载均衡咋设置

    在Ubuntu系统中设置集群负载均衡,您可以选择多种工具和技术。以下是一些常见的方法:
    使用HAProxy
    HAProxy是一个高性能的TCP/HTTP负载均衡器,适用于...